Ridglea
Two golf courses and several courts at Ridglea Country Club
Ridglea Country Club sits in the heart of the Ridglea Hills. The membership-only club opened in 1954 and includes a north course with narrow fairways and small greens and a south course with less terrain. Beyond golf, members can dive into the deep end of the pool or swim laps in the marked lanes. Tennis and pickleball players grab their racquets and practice their swing at one of the 11 hard courts or three pickleball courts. Wedged between the club's north and south courses, Ridglea Hills Park provides a vibrant red-and-yellow playground where kids race through the woodchips between two slides and a merry-go-round. Dogs run through the North Z Boaz Dog Park, 10 acres built on a former golf course with accessible ponds and agility structures. Prominent yards and broad, bushy trees decorate the streets in the central and southern areas of the Ridglea neighborhood. Appropriately named Ridglea Hills has limited sidewalks; however, wide streets offer ample room to stroll the community. The northern end of the neighborhood sits on flatter land and includes more sidewalks and wider roads with street parking. Houses typically cost between $250,000 for a ranch style and more than $1 million for a modern, mid-century or Colonial Revival home. On the north end of Ridglea, shopping and dining options exist along Camp Bowie Boulevard. Whole Foods, Sprouts Farmer's Market and Walmart Neighborhood Market are several nearby grocery stores. Drew's Place Soulfood offers southern favorites with a skylit interior and outdoor patio décor. Galligaskins Submarines Restaurant and Catering serves submarine sandwiches and burgers to patrons seated in green booths, with red walls and a wooden silhouette cutout of Texas as a backdrop. The community gets involved in holiday festivities. During the Christmas season, multicolored lights decorate the streets and glisten along Luther Lake. "Throughout the neighborhood, you will find very elaborate displays," Schweitzer says. Luther Lake also hosts a big party for Independence Day in the summer, including a large fireworks show.National champion cheerleading at Arlington Heights High
Ridglea students may start at Ridglea Hills Elementary School, which receives a B rating from Niche. Ridglea Hills participates in a 1:1 Chromebook program, providing students with digital devices to facilitate learning. Schweitzer says there is a lot of community and parent involvement with the school. William Monnig Middle School earns a C-plus and provides students with art-centric electives like jazz, theater, photography and choir. Arlington Heights High School, a B-plus-rated institution, won its first two National Cheerleading Association national championships in competitive cheerleading in 2024.Take Interstate 30 straight to downtown Fort Worth
There is little public transportation; most errands require a car. Interstate 30 leads straight to downtown Fort Worth, about seven miles to the east. Fort Worth Meacham International Airport is about 16 miles northeast, while the DFW International Airport is about 35 miles northeast.

On average, homes in Ridglea, Fort Worth sell after 54 days on the market compared to the national average of 51 days. The median sale price for homes in Ridglea, Fort Worth over the last 12 months is $465,000, up 9%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
